SDSU Track & Field Splits Squads at Stanford and UC San Diego Meets This Weekend
Coming off a successful outing at the 38th annual Aztec Invitational, the San Diego State track and field team splits squads this weekend with some athletes heading to the Stanford Invitational on Friday and Saturday, and the rest of the team slated to compete at the California Collegiate Invitational at nearby UC San Diego in La Jolla, Calif.

Eighteen Aztecs are currently entered at the Stanford Invite, led by the reigning Mountain West Women's Track and Field Outdoor Athlete of the Week winner Ashley Henderson. Henderson, who won the open 100, invitational 100, invitational 200 and a leg on the winning invitational 4x100 relay, will run the 100 and 200 this weekend, and could run a leg in either the 4x100 or 4x400 as well.

Micha Auzenne, who won both the 60 and 60-meter hurdles at the MW Indoor Championships, will be making her individual outdoor debut in both the 100 and 100 hurdles.

Others specifically entered in track events include Sierra Brabham-Lawrence (100H, 400H), Jazmen Bunch (100, 200), Madison Gipson (100H, 400H), Simone Glenn (200, 400), Ellison Grove (800), Lakin Hatcher (200, 400), Tyra Lea (200, 400) and Courtney Robinson (100H, 400H).

In the field events, Rachel Alesi is slated to compete in the shot put and invitational discus throw, Je'Neal Ainsworth in the invitational triple jump, Lisa-Anne Barrow in the long jump, Alexa Evans in the shot put and invitational discus throw, and Jelena McNown in the long jump.

Multi-event specialists Kassidy Ellis (100H, high jump, long jump) and Karsen Sper (100H, high jump) will also be competing in multiple events, while Starlynn Singleton is entered in the 100 and triple jump.

Friday gets underway with the collegiate shot put at 11 a.m. PT, while the track events start at 11:27 a.m. PT with the prelims of the 100 hurdles for SDSU. The first day ends at 5 p.m. PT with the final of the 100.

On Saturday, the Aztecs' first event will be the 4x100 at 1:02 p.m. (discus invitational at 3 p.m. PT for the field events) and ends with the 4x400 at 5 p.m. PT.
